FAQ:
Q: Is it okay to eat honey every day?
A: Yes! When consumed in moderation (1–2 tablespoons per day), honey can be a beneficial part of your diet thanks to its antioxidants, antimicrobial properties, and trace minerals.
Q: Can diabetics consume honey?
A: People with diabetes should consult their doctor before adding honey to their diet, as it can still raise blood sugar levels despite being natural.
Q: What type of honey is best?
A: Raw, unprocessed, and organic honey is the most beneficial. Manuka honey is known for its particularly potent antibacterial properties.
Q: Can I give honey to children?
A: Never give honey to children under 1 year old due to the risk of infant botulism.
Q: Will this help with weight loss?
A: While not a magic solution, honey can help support metabolism and reduce sugar cravings when used in place of refined sugar.
